discomfitor pushed a commit to branch enlightenment-0.21. http://git.enlightenment.org/core/enlightenment.git/commit/?id=70d5ebb66e6537d2cda7e952acf3d9a1e979475f
commit 70d5ebb66e6537d2cda7e952acf3d9a1e979475f Author: Mike Blumenkrantz <[email protected]> Date: Fri Mar 17 13:17:02 2017 -0400 send wl client resize edges during focus-in/out send_configure avoid prematurely terminating resize operations --- src/bin/e_comp_wl.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/bin/e_comp_wl.c b/src/bin/e_comp_wl.c index 52998c5..13cbfd6 100644 --- a/src/bin/e_comp_wl.c +++ b/src/bin/e_comp_wl.c @@ -2482,7 +2482,7 @@ _e_comp_wl_client_cb_focus_set(void *data EINA_UNUSED, E_Client *ec) if (ec->comp_data->shell.configure_send) { if (ec->comp_data->shell.surface) - _e_comp_wl_configure_send(ec, 0); + _e_comp_wl_configure_send(ec, 1); } //if ((ec->icccm.take_focus) && (ec->icccm.accepts_focus)) @@ -2506,7 +2506,7 @@ _e_comp_wl_client_cb_focus_unset(void *data EINA_UNUSED, E_Client *ec) if (ec->comp_data->shell.configure_send) { if (ec->comp_data->shell.surface) - _e_comp_wl_configure_send(ec, 0); + _e_comp_wl_configure_send(ec, 1); } _e_comp_wl_focus_check(); --
